Boeing and Thai finalize the contract for six additional 777-300 ERs

Boeing and Thai Airways International (Bangkok) on August 18 finalized a firm order for six additional 777-300 Extended Range (ER) airplanes.

The order completes an agreement to purchase Boeing 777-300 ERs announced during the Paris Air Show in June 2011.

Thai currently operates nearly every 777 model produced, including the 777-200, 777-200 ER, 777-300 and 777-300 ER. In addition, Thai Cargo became the first carrier in Southeast Asia to utilize the 777 Freighter which are operated by Southern Air.
